5个跨平台实战技巧:OpenCore配置工具双系统操作指南
OpenCore配置工具如何在Windows与macOS环境下实现无缝切换?双系统用户如何利用跨平台EFI制作工具提升Hackintosh配置效率?本文将通过实战角度,探索OpCore Simplify这款自动化工具在不同操作系统中的应用差异,帮助你掌握双系统Hackintosh工具的核心使用方法。作为一款专为简化OpenCore EFI创建而设计的工具,OpCore Simplify通过硬件自动检测、ACPI补丁生成和kext智能配置,为跨平台用户提供了统一的解决方案。
核心问题:如何选择适合自己的操作平台?
在开始使用OpenCore配置工具前,首先需要确定最适合你的操作环境。以下决策树将帮助你根据实际需求做出选择:
是否需要原生硬件报告生成?
│
├─ 是 → Windows平台(支持一键导出硬件信息)
│
└─ 否 → 已有硬件报告?
│
├─ 是 → macOS平台(原生Python环境支持)
│
└─ 否 → Windows平台(先完成硬件检测)
Windows平台优势在于硬件信息采集的便捷性,而macOS平台则胜在系统集成度和操作流畅性。对于大多数首次使用的用户,建议从Windows平台开始,利用其硬件报告导出功能获取完整的系统信息。
硬件报告选择界面
核心问题:不同平台的启动流程有何差异?
Windows平台:图形化引导式启动
Windows用户通过批处理脚本启动工具,享受完整的图形化操作体验:
# 无需复杂命令,双击启动
OpCore-Simplify.bat
启动流程解析:
- 自动检测Python环境,缺失时提供安装引导
- 加载硬件检测模块,准备系统信息采集
- 启动图形化界面,进入四步式配置向导
- 提供硬件报告导出选项,生成JSON格式系统信息
进阶技巧:按住Shift键双击批处理文件可进入高级模式,开启额外的硬件诊断选项和日志记录功能,有助于排查复杂的硬件兼容性问题。
macOS平台:终端驱动的高效工作流
macOS用户通过命令行方式启动,适合熟悉终端操作的进阶用户:
# 赋予执行权限(首次运行)
chmod +x OpCore-Simplify.command
# 启动工具
./OpCore-Simplify.command
启动流程解析:
- 利用系统预装Python环境,无需额外配置
- 通过终端输出实时显示工具运行状态
- 提供文本菜单导航,支持键盘快捷键操作
- 需要手动导入Windows生成的硬件报告
进阶技巧:在终端中使用./OpCore-Simplify.command --debug启动调试模式,可查看详细的日志输出,帮助诊断配置过程中的异常问题。
核心问题:如何高效完成跨平台配置流程?
无论是Windows还是macOS平台,OpCore Simplify都遵循统一的核心配置流程,但实现方式因系统特性而有所不同。以下流程图展示了双平台的操作路径差异:
开始
│
├─ Windows平台 ──────┬─ 导出硬件报告 ──┐
│ │ │
│ └─ 导入硬件报告 ──┼─ 硬件兼容性检查 ──┐
│ │ │
└─ macOS平台 ───────────────────────────┘ │
│
▼
配置ACPI补丁和kext
│
▼
选择SMBIOS模型
│
▼
生成OpenCore EFI
│
▼
结束
硬件兼容性检查界面
在硬件兼容性检查阶段,工具会自动分析CPU、显卡、声卡等关键组件的macOS支持情况,并提供兼容性报告和解决方案建议。如图所示,工具清晰标记了支持和不支持的硬件组件,帮助用户提前了解潜在问题。
核心问题:如何应对平台特定的常见问题?
Windows平台常见问题诊断
-
Python环境安装失败
- 症状:启动脚本提示Python未安装
- 解决方案:
# 手动安装Python 3.8+并添加到环境变量 # 验证安装 python --version
-
硬件报告导出失败
- 症状:点击"Export Hardware Report"无响应
- 解决方案:以管理员身份运行批处理文件,确保系统权限足够
macOS平台常见问题诊断
-
脚本权限错误
- 症状:终端提示"Permission denied"
- 解决方案:
# 修复文件权限 chmod 755 OpCore-Simplify.command
-
硬件报告导入失败
- 症状:提示"Invalid report format"
- 解决方案:确保使用Windows平台生成的最新版报告,旧版本格式可能不兼容
配置页面界面
配置页面是工具的核心功能区,提供ACPI补丁配置、内核扩展管理、音频布局设置和SMBIOS模型选择等关键功能。无论使用哪个平台,这些核心功能的参数设置保持一致,确保生成的EFI文件具有跨平台兼容性。
核心问题:如何优化跨平台工作流?
跨平台数据共享策略
-
硬件报告管理
- 在Windows平台生成硬件报告后,保存至云存储或U盘
- 在macOS平台通过"Select Hardware Report"功能导入
-
配置文件同步
- 使用Git跟踪配置文件变更:
# 初始化仓库(首次使用) git init git add *.json git commit -m "Initial config" # 跨平台同步时 git pull # 或 git push
- 使用Git跟踪配置文件变更:
双系统协作技巧
- 在Windows完成硬件检测和初步配置
- 在macOS进行高级设置和EFI生成
- 使用虚拟机测试不同平台的配置结果
- 定期备份EFI文件夹,防止配置丢失
通过以上实战技巧,你可以充分发挥OpCore Simplify作为跨平台EFI制作工具的优势,无论使用Windows还是macOS环境,都能高效完成OpenCore配置工作。记住,工具只是辅助,理解硬件与软件的兼容性原理才是成功构建Hackintosh系统的关键。随着经验积累,你将能够根据具体硬件情况,灵活调整配置策略,实现稳定高效的黑苹果体验。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ust093-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00